Sussex Montessori receives two grants for capital improvements

Posted

SEAFORD — Sussex Montessori Public Charter School was joined by U.S. Sen. Tom Carper and representatives from the offices of U.S. Sen. Chris Coons and U.S. Rep. Lisa Blunt Rochester, all D-Del., as well as members of the U.S. Department of Agriculture’s Rural Development, on Nov. 18 to announce two grants totaling nearly $400,000 from Rural Development to the school.

Sussex Montessori, serving grades K-6, received the monies to fund capital improvements to its campus.

The grants will facilitate additional classrooms, a natural playground, outdoor learning spaces and other projects.

The school is required to match these funds and has raised approximately 50% of the match. Its Giving Tuesday campaign was also dedicated to the project.
